Description

The MIC-KEY Low Profile Gastric-Jejunal Tube is a specialized medical device designed to provide effective enteral feeding solutions for both pediatric and adult patients. Its low-profile design ensures comfort and discretion, sitting flush at the skin level, often referred to as a "button" tube. This design is particularly beneficial for long-term use, offering dual functionality with its gastric and jejunal access ports.

Key Features

  • Dual Access Ports: The tube includes a jejunal port for direct feeding into the small intestine and a gastric port for stomach decompression, venting, or medication administration.
  • Balloon Retention Mechanism: Secured internally by an inflatable silicone balloon, ensuring the tube remains in place with minimal discomfort.
  • External Bolster: Features clearly labeled ports for easy identification and management.

Advanced Design

Each port is equipped with a one-way valve, activated by attaching a MIC-KEY Extension Set, which can be detached when not in use. This enhances the tube's versatility and ease of use. The device also includes a radiopaque stripe and tungsten weighting for clear visualization under imaging, aiding in accurate placement.

Material and Sterilization

Constructed from medical-grade silicone, the tube is gamma sterilized to ensure patient safety. Its tapered distal tip facilitates smoother insertion, reducing potential trauma during placement.

Size Variability

Available in French sizes ranging from 16 Fr to 22 Fr, with stoma lengths from 2.0 cm to 7.0 cm, and a jejunal length up to 45 cm for adult sizes. The balloon volume varies, accommodating pediatric needs up to 5 mL and adult needs up to 10 mL, using sterile or distilled water.

Intended Use

The MIC-KEY GJ-Tube is ideal for patients requiring simultaneous gastric decompression and jejunal feeding, suitable for administering nutrition, hydration, and medications. It requires professional placement through endoscopic or surgical procedures and should be managed under physician supervision.

Maintenance Guidelines

Regular maintenance includes checking balloon water volume weekly and ensuring thorough cleaning of the tube and extension sets to prevent clogging and infection. Flushing with water before and after feeds or medications is recommended, and specific syringes should be used as per clinical guidance.

Important Considerations

Users are advised not to rotate the tube to prevent migration, and the external bolster should rest slightly above the skin. Extension sets should be changed according to clinical advice. Detailed instructions, contraindications, and warnings are provided in the official Instructions for Use (IFU), emphasizing the importance of adhering to professional medical guidance for safe and effective use.
